Description
The 330102-00-24-50-02-00 3300 XL 8 mm Proximity Probe is designed for demanding industrial automation environments where highly accurate displacement, vibration, and shaft position data are essential for predictive maintenance and real-time machine diagnostics. Using eddy current sensing technology, the 3300 XL 8 mm probe delivers linearized output across a 2 mm measurement range, enabling precise monitoring of dynamic vibration and static shaft position on fluid-film bearing machines, turbines, compressors, and rotating drives commonly found in petrochemical, refineries, and power generation facilities. Built with a patented TipLoc and CableLoc mechanical design, the probe ensures mechanical strength and superior pull resistance (up to 330 N) while maintaining API 670 compliance for accuracy, temperature stability, and installation configuration. The 330102-00-24-50-02-00 3300 XL 8 mm Proximity Probe features miniature coaxial ClickLoc connectors, a 5-meter cable, and a robust operating temperature range from −52°C to +177°C, enabling stable condition monitoring in harsh industrial settings with elevated heat exposure. Full backward compatibility with legacy 3300 series components simplifies field interchangeability and eliminates the requirement for matched calibration between cables, probes, and Proximitor sensors. This makes the 3300 XL 8 mm an optimal choice for integrating vibration monitoring, Keyphasor speed detection, and position measurement into modern automated reliability programs.

Specifications
|
Operating and Storage Temperature: |
-52°C to +177°C (-62°F to +350°F) |
|
Supply Sensitivity: |
Less than 2 mV change in output voltage per volt change in input voltage |
|
Output Resistance: |
50 Ω |
|
Extension Cable Capacitance: |
69.9 pF/m (21.3 pF/ft) typical |
|
Field Wiring: |
0.2 to 1.5 mm2 (16 to 24 AWG) |
|
Linear Range: |
2 mm (80 mils) |
